Transaction 4106633ac69a4c9e13db87e9a76254c176ec504bc40ccf2dc126d2bf0ddac441
1 Input
1 Output
-
4106633ac69a4c9e13db87e9a76254c176ec504bc40ccf2dc126d2bf0ddac441:0
- value
- 71141883
- script pubkey
- OP_0 OP_PUSHBYTES_20 650d6c3b1f590486690a51ef491d206bc80ae2a0
- address
- bc1qv5xkcwcltyzgv6g228h5j8fqd0yq4c4qeqc4e4